After beating the Scorchers, the Sixers are now closer to a top two finish. They are in great form too especially after beating a side that is on the top of the table. The upcoming game though is very important for the Strikers. Standing at fourth place with ten points, the Strikers are still in a good position but a win here will cement their place in the top four allowing them some breathing space.

The Weather at Coffs Harbour is pretty good for the upcoming game.
A flat track at Coffs Harbour is expected and batting second will be a better option.

Matt Short is in an impressive run of form. He is batting with some intent and making a lot of magic happen with his aggressive batting, giving the Strikers some hope as he is out in the middle.
Steve Smith got a decent start this BBL and is pretty aggressive in his approach too. His batting looks good at the top and Sydney will be pleased with his results to start with.
